One of the fun things we did was played some Minute 2 Win It games.  I had several games geared toward kids (ages 3 to 10) that they really enjoyed.  One in particular was a "straw and stars" game.  You cut out small stars from card stock or scrapbook paper (I used a star punch that was about 1") and gave each contestant a straw.  They had to suck a star to the bottom of the straw and transport it a few feet away into a bowl and collect as many as they could in one minute.
 As you can see in the top left hand picture and the center picture that the adults participated in a "Kissmas Ball" relay race.  The object was to transport the Christmas ornament across the room and drop it into a bowl using only your lips.
